As a Power System Engineer, you will collaborate closely with a cross-functional team to integrate power supply requirements into the overall satellite architecture. Your expertise in specifying, designing, and validating robust satellite power systems, including solar arrays and power distribution systems, will be critical in ensuring continuous energy supply for mission operations.

Your Mission
  • Development and management of all EPS requirements
  • Perform conceptual sizing, modeling, and trade studies for the EPS architecture, including solar arrays, batteries, and PCU
  • Create, manage, and control spacecraft power budget and define all operational power modes
  • Primary technical interface with component suppliers, leading technical evaluations, hardware selection, data exchange and performance verification
  • Execute the detailed electrical design of EPS, defining all internal and external interfaces
  • Support the execution of AIT and verification plans to ensure the EPS meets all requirements
  • Support launch campaign operations and subsequent in-orbit commissioning and anomaly resolution for the power subsystem
  • Manage the EPS project schedule, risks, and deliverables, preparing technical documentation, design review materials, and formal reports

About Us

Reflex Aerospace, a NewSpace startup founded in 2021 and headquartered in Munich and Berlin, has been leading the charge to provide advanced dual-use satellite technology at unparalleled speed. The company is leveraging the latest techniques to modernize payload-centric satellite development and production, achieving significantly faster delivery times and enhanced reliability. By applying algorithmic engineering and streamlined system design processes, Reflex accelerates the delivery of satellites enabling lightning-fast innovation for our customers.
